The Radeon Pro W6600X GPU by Unknown. features a RDNA 2.0 (2020−2024) architecture. with 2048 CUDA cores. and a boost clock of 2479 MHz MHz. It offers GDDR6 memory with 8 GB GB capacity and a 128 Bit-bit interface. delivering a bandwidth of 256.0 GB/s GB/s. With a power consumption (TDP) of 120W. it supports DirectX 12 Ultimate (12_2), Vulkan 1.3 for enhanced performance.
